Abstract

'Portrait of Humanity Vol 4', 320pp, cloth spine, 151 x 199mm.

In collaboration with 1854 Media/British Journal of Photography

In an age of soaring uncertainty, small moments of connection – with ourselves and our planet – matter more than ever before. The 200 intimate portraits in this volume tell stories of courage, hardship and hope, across continents and through generations.

With an introduction by Rachel Segal Hamilton
